I finally got around to getting the Nordskog oil and temperature sending units installed. I followed the directions, checked all connections twice and got pretty much the same results as before. I checked the engine coolant temperature at the gooseneck and at the head where the sending unit is located with an I.R. temperature gun, the gooseneck read about 115 degrees and approximately 160 degrees at the head, meanwhile the temperature gauge is reporting 215 degrees. Not good, and the oil temperature gauge is still starting out in the negative numbers.

I had the same problem with Cyberdyne, they suggested a noise filter to cut down on ignition noise, and a new wire for the ground to the gauges because of a floating ground. Put on at the battery.
Here is whatI put on the hot line to ingition and gauges.
MSD Noise Filters/Noise Capacitor, MSD 8830 http://store.summitracing.com
After the filter and new wire the problem was gone.
